NSPopoverTouchBarItemMBS class
Super class: NSTouchBarItemMBS
Type | Topic | Plugin | Version | macOS | Windows | Linux | iOS | Targets |
class | TouchBar | MBS Mac64bit Plugin | 16.5 | ✅ Yes | ❌ No | ❌ No | ❌ No | Desktop only |
Subclass of the NSTouchBarItemMBS class.
- 7 properties
- property collapsedRepresentation as NSViewMBS
- property collapsedRepresentationImage as NSImageMBS
- property collapsedRepresentationLabel as String
- property customizationLabel as String
- property popoverTouchBar as NSTouchBarMBS
- property pressAndHoldTouchBar as NSTouchBarMBS
- property showsCloseButton as Boolean
- 3 methods
- method Constructor(identifier as string)
- method dismissPopover
- method showPopover
